US President Donald Trump’s ongoing visit to China drew global attention after Chinese President Xi Jinping warned that mishandling the Taiwan issue could push relations between the two countries toward conflict. During high-level talks in Beijing, Xi reportedly described Taiwan as the most sensitive matter in US-China relations and cautioned that any interference could seriously damage ties between the two nations.
Chinese officials said Xi stressed the importance of maintaining stability and mutual respect while dealing with issues related to Taiwan. The warning comes at a time when tensions between Washington and Beijing remain high over trade, technology, and military activity in the Indo-Pacific region. President Trump, while addressing reporters during the visit, maintained a positive tone and said both countries were working toward improving communication and strengthening economic cooperation. He also praised Xi’s leadership and expressed hope for “stable and productive” relations.
Apart from geopolitical concerns, the discussions also focused on trade agreements, tariffs, semiconductor restrictions, and global security matters. Business representatives accompanying the US delegation are reportedly exploring opportunities for expanded economic partnerships with Chinese firms. Taiwan continues to remain a major flashpoint between the world’s two largest economies. China considers Taiwan part of its territory under the “One China” policy, while the United States maintains unofficial ties with the island and continues to provide military support and defense equipment.
International analysts believe Xi’s latest remarks reflect Beijing’s growing concern over increasing US involvement in the Taiwan Strait. Experts warn that any escalation in the region could affect global markets, supply chains, and international security. The Trump-Xi meeting is being closely watched worldwide as both leaders attempt to balance economic cooperation with rising strategic rivalry. Further discussions between the two sides are expected in the coming days.
